SEAT BELTS
2
Getting to know your vehicle - 25
|
Adjusting the second row centre
seat belts (depending on vehicle)
Fasten sliding latch
12
into the red
buckle
13
.
Adjusting the third row side seat
belts
Fasten latch
14
into the red buckle
15
.
Adjust the seat belt strap as indicated
in the image for height adjustment.
Check that the rear seat
belts are positioned and
operating correctly each
time the rear bench seat
is moved.
No modification may
be made to the compo-
nent parts of the original-
ly fitted restraint system: seat
belts, seats and their mountings.
For special operations (e.g. fitting
child seats), contact an autho-
rised dealer.
Do not use devices which allow
any slack in the belts (e.g. clothes
pegs, clips, etc.): a seat belt
which is worn too loosely may
cause injury in the event of an ac-
cident.
Never wear the shoulder strap
under your arm or behind your
back.
Never use the same belt for
more than one person and never
hold a baby or child on your lap
with your seat belt around them.
The belt should never be twist-
ed.
Following an accident, have the
seat belts checked and replaced if
necessary. Always replace your
seat belts as soon as they show
any signs of wear.
